Garage in Back House Plans

Garage in back house plans have become increasingly popular in recent years, offering a number of benefits over traditional front-facing garages. These homes are designed with the primary living spaces oriented towards the front of the home, while the garage is located at the back or side of the property. This arrangement allows for a more private and secluded living environment, as well as a more aesthetically pleasing streetscape.

There are many different reasons why someone might choose a garage in back house plan. Some people may prefer the privacy of having the garage out of sight from the street. Others may want to create a more welcoming and inviting front yard, or they may simply want to have more space in their front yard for other purposes, such as a pool or a garden.

Whatever the reason, garage in back house plans offer a number of advantages:

  • Privacy: One of the biggest benefits of a garage in back house plan is the increased privacy it offers. With a front-facing garage, the garage door is often the focal point of the home's facade, which can make it feel less private and more exposed. By placing the garage in the back, you can create a more secluded and private living space.
  • Aesthetics: Garage in back house plans can also be more aesthetically pleasing than traditional front-facing garages. With a front-facing garage, the garage door is often the dominant feature of the home's exterior. This can make the home look cluttered and uninviting. By placing the garage in the back, you can create a more balanced and harmonious exterior.
  • Increased curb appeal: Garage in back house plans can also increase the curb appeal of your home. A well-landscaped front yard can add value to your home and make it more appealing to potential buyers.
  • More space: By placing the garage in the back, you can free up space in your front yard for other purposes, such as a pool, a garden, or a play area for children.

Of course, there are also some disadvantages to garage in back house plans. One potential drawback is that it can be more difficult to access the garage from the street. This can be a problem if you need to frequently access your garage, or if you have a large vehicle that needs to be parked inside.

Another potential drawback is that garage in back house plans can be more expensive to build than traditional front-facing garages. This is because the builder will need to run additional plumbing and electrical lines to the back of the house.

Overall, garage in back house plans offer a number of advantages over traditional front-facing garages. These homes are more private, more aesthetically pleasing, and they can increase the curb appeal of your home. However, it is important to consider the potential drawbacks before making a decision.
